### sch.63-sec.13 Deciding applications
The authority must consider, and decide to approve or refuse to approve, each application for assistance under the scheme.
The authority may approve a lesser amount of assistance than applied for in the application.
The authority must refuse to approve an application if the authority’s assistance funds for the scheme are insufficient to pay for the assistance.
If the authority refuses to approve an application, the authority must give the applicant written notice of the decision.
